John Deere is best known for being an inventor in the agricultural space. When the blacksmith noticed he was often making the same repairs to wood and cast-iron plows used by farmers, he began experimenting with more durable plow designs, which he then sold to local farmers. His steel plows exploded in popularity among many farmers, with Deere’s company producing 1,600 plows in 1850. That same year, the company started producing other tools in addition to plows.

From Hongtou, you can take cross-island “highway” #81 to reach Yeyin on the east coast in 15 minutes. Halfway there, you can stop for a 30 minute walk (scooters aren’t allowed because the road going up there is to steep) to the Orchid Island Weather Station, which boasts bird’s eye views of the island. The remote south coast is home to the Lanyu Nuclear Waste Storage Facility, a controversial facility that has always been opposed by the local Tao people and was in recent years found to have safety flaws. The north coast is also quite remote, and there you’ll find traditional Langdao Village and several large rock formations.
One is the former residence of Sugamiya Katsutaro, the chief architect and the fishing port. Located next to Xingang Church, it is the only two-story Japanese traditional building in Eastern Taiwan. Suffering significant typhoon damage, the building underwent renovations in 2019, and it is expected to reopen next year. Painstakingly chipping away at the exposed bluff, the aim was to create a striking 172-metre-high image of the great Lakota warrior astride his horse, arm outstretched pointing towards the lands of his people. At the time, 31-year-old Ziolkowski was working on Mount Rushmore, the iconic memorial to four US presidents, which is located in the Lakota’s spiritual heartland, the Black Hills of South Dakota. Standing Bear had already petitioned Mount Rushmore’s lead sculptor, Gutzon Borglum, to include the revered Lakota leader Crazy Horse in the memorial to no avail. Along with Steve Wozniak, Steve Jobs was an inventor behind Apple Computers. As the now-famous story goes, Jobs and Wozniak started Apple Computers in Jobs’ family’s garage in 1976, and the work they did there made computers more accessible and more affordable for consumers. Jobs left Apple in 1985, but he returned in 1997 and revitalized the company, leading to the creation of products like the iPod and iPhone.
